These 10 films are a perfect primer into the world of horror westerns. Frontier living is harsh, but throwing horror into the mix makes it downright brutal. This makes for a perfect time to look back at some of the best horror westerns that have come before. On Friday, IFC Midnight is releasing Emmi Tammi’s The Wind, a western frontier set horror film in which its lead might be dealing with a demonic presence. And both the western and horror genres are fond of exploring unknown frontiers. The isolation, the ever-present danger of starvation or brutal conditions, and the general rougher way of life in westerns make for a great foundation for horror stories. Of all the many subsets and genre mashups of horror, the horror western seems like a match made in heaven.
